Debt Investments Remain Relevant for Investors, Says HDFC AMC's Anupam Joshi

At the recent Moneycontrol Dezerv Wealth Summit in Bangalore, HDFC AMC's Anupam Joshi outlined four key reasons why fixed income should continue to play an important role in investor portfolios. According to Joshi, fixed income remains valuable not only for portfolio stability but also for liquidity, tax efficiency, and long-term wealth creation opportunities.

Fixed income investments offer investors a steady pool of capital during emergencies and can generally be liquidated without significant impact costs. This stability helps reduce overall portfolio volatility during periods of uncertainty. Moreover, fixed income investments provide tax flexibility, allowing investors to defer taxation until redemption.

Debt mutual funds, in particular, offer favorable tax treatment, with investments held for more than two years attracting taxation of nearly 12.5%. This gives investors flexibility to redeem investments later in life, potentially when they fall into a lower income-tax bracket after retirement.

India's long-term economic growth story also strengthens the case for debt investments. As the economy transitions from developing to developed markets, trend growth, inflation, and interest rates typically moderate over time. In such an environment, current long-term yields present an opportunity for investors to lock in attractive returns for extended periods.

According to Joshi, if India sustains long-term growth of around 6% to 6.5% alongside inflation of 4% to 5%, current long-duration bond yields offer attractive positive real returns. In fact, India's 30- and 40-year bond yields are now nearing levels around 7.8%, which Joshi described as attractive for long-term investors.

Outlook for Interest Rates

On his outlook for interest rates, Joshi expects the Reserve Bank of India to raise interest rates over the coming quarters amid rising inflationary pressures and geopolitical uncertainty. He expects the RBI to raise rates by 75 to 100 basis points over the next four to six quarters, though the pace of tightening will depend on how inflation and growth evolve.

Given the uncertain environment and the likelihood of tighter global monetary policy across major economies, Joshi recommends that investors currently prefer shorter-duration debt products, particularly one-year and one-to-three-year duration strategies. However, he also emphasized that bond markets are forward-looking and may have already priced in much of the expected tightening cycle.
